Transaction e76812aa26b12eb72ee9548ceba390a788ea3d738946cc24a005da2c040d8cbf
1 Input
1 Output
-
e76812aa26b12eb72ee9548ceba390a788ea3d738946cc24a005da2c040d8cbf:0
- value
- 199962392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bdd2dde6da8f07e01d1a0e7f592c21c3e9a6c7d OP_EQUAL
- address
- 3ESYp1Lmb7cMMwMwFVXJ4T4s935zgWwAyS